hi ladies! I am a cooking newbie!!!

Recently me and L have been trying to eat new food, stuff we've not made before, stuff we didn't think we'd like etc. I made sausage casserole last week which worked out brilliantly, and now we want to try fish pie!

Problem is, i cant eat any type of shellfish. so, what fish can i put in it? All the recipies i see include prawns :shrug:

What fish goes well with salmon? we like pretty much anything, but i know certain fishes dont taste right etc. Any decent recipies? heeeelp!!

I make a fish pie without prawns and just use salmon and a cheap smoked fish like coley and its delicious. Just poach your fish in milk for 5 mins then strain the milk and put aside for your sauce for later. Boil and mash your potatoes, fry off some leeks in butter. When your leeks are softened, make a basic white sauce with butter and flour then add the milk and keep stirring till thick and creamy then add in the leeks, peas and sweetcorn, you can add dill aswell or parsley which is really nice. Flake the fish into the sauce and mix carefully then pour in a baking dish and top with the mash, cook till browned on top its so yummy :)
 
i just make it with any fish i fancy- cod or haddock. i dont often use smoked fish coz it gives me heartburn but if i do its half and half "normal" to smoked fish, boil it, make white sauce with a bit of mustard, mix it all together top with mash and oven it to finish it off.

last time i did it i chucked in loads of veg instead of having them on the side and it was amazing!! sweetcorn, carrots, peas and broccoli in the sauce then i put them all in individual ramekin dishes.

I use salmon and a cheapish smoked fish hun. If you don't like smoked fish, you can buy any white fish you fancy, but it won't have as much taste to it. Good luck with it xx
 
i just normally use cod...its the only fish i can stomach so adam has a fishy meal lol i just cook up some cod..its usually ready when its white :) chop that up into chunks..make a cheese sauce (i usually get a bisto one :blush:) and get a bit of parsley..just a dash if its dried.. a few leaves chopped if fresh, bung that mixture with the fish into an oven bowl top with mash and grated cheese and vola :p thats as simple as i make it

I use whatever I have in the freezer! Generally salmon and smoked fish (we include prawns if we have them). I poach this, make a cheese sauce including the poaching milk and add some parsely or whatever I fancy. I boil an egg (hard boiled) and chop this up, flake the fish and put it in the pie dish with the egg and pour over the sauce. Top with mash and put it in the oven til it's browny on top.
I've also done it with veg in (grated carrot and celery is what Jamie Oliver does I think) and without the egg. It's very easy to chop and change and once you've found the right recipe for you it's so easy to make.
 
Ooh yum, its not a proper fish pie without boiled egg. I thought it sounded really disgusting when i first heard it, but i tried it and the flavours really work!

I make my fish pie pretty much the same as the other recipes here, but i use 3 types of fish (salmon, smoked haddock and a white fish) and prawns, peas, broccoli, white sauce using the milk i used to cook the fish, dill, parsley and boiled egg. mash to top, and if i want a little change i use half n half normal mash and sweet potato mash (yum) top with breadcrumbs and grated cheese and oven cook til its golden.
